Global Markets Review and Report

Asian stocks surged on Thursday, 2 December 2010, after improved economic indicators powered big gains on Wall Street and worries eased about Europe's debt problems. The key benchmark indices in China, Hong Kong, Japan, Indonesia, South Korea, Singapore and Taiwan rose by between 0.4% to 1.78%.

Stocks jumped, sending U.S. benchmark indexes to their biggest gains in three months, while the euro and commodities rallied and Treasuries slid amid improving data on the American and Chinese economies and speculation of a larger effort to end Europe's debt crisis.

The European Central Bank is expected to keep unlimited liquidity operations in place for longer with the euro zone debt crisis raging unabated, but is unlikely to announce mass new bond purchases on Thursday.

Report on Indian and Global Stock Market

Indian Market:

30-share BSE Sensex closed at 19,521.25, up 116.15 points or 0.60%, after seeing recovery of 303.23 points from day's low of 19,218.02. The broader indices outperformed benchmarks; BSE Midcap Index was up 1.4% and Smallcap up 1.9%.

The RBI has also further eased Statutory Liquidity Ratio (SLR) requirements as a temporary measure. Banks can now maintain a lower SLR that is two percentage points less than the current requirement. Earlier, they were allowed a one percentage point relief.

Telecom value-added services provider One97 Communications Ltd has delayed its initial public offering by about two weeks due to the current market volatility.
